Argentina Receives $42 Billion Bailout Amidst Austerity Measures
International institutions bailed out Argentina with $42 billion, led by a $20 billion IMF loan, in response to President Javier Milei's austerity measures that decreased inflation from 211% to 55.9% while causing recession and protests.

Argentina Lifts Capital Controls in High-Stakes IMF-Backed Gamble
Argentina's libertarian government will lift most capital controls next week, thanks to a new $20 billion IMF loan; this risky move aims to attract foreign investment but could cause a currency crisis and higher inflation.

Argentina Eases Currency Controls After Securing $32 Billion in International Loans
Argentina's central bank eased currency controls, allowing unlimited US dollar purchases and a floating exchange rate between 1,000 and 14,000 pesos per dollar, following $32 billion in loans from the IMF and World Bank to address its economic crisis.

Argentina Receives $42 Billion in International Aid to Stabilize Economy
Argentina received a $20 billion loan from the IMF, a $12 billion loan from the World Bank, and up to $10 billion from the IDB to stabilize its economy, lift exchange controls, and end the $200 monthly dollar limit.

Argentina Ends Currency Controls, Seeks IMF Support Amid High Inflation
Argentina ended currency controls on Friday, letting the peso float freely between 1000 and 1400 per dollar, supported by a $20 billion IMF loan and additional funds from multilateral banks, aiming to curb inflation and attract investment despite recent inflation reaching 3.7% in March.
